Decoding Productivity: The Science of Peak Performance States

Those rare moments when you're completely absorbed in your work, losing track of time while ideas flow effortlessly—often called "flow" or "being in the zone"—represent the pinnacle of human productivity. The concept, first extensively researched by psychologist Mihaly Csikszentmihalyi, describes a state where challenge and skill level intersect perfectly, creating conditions where productivity naturally amplifies.

Neuroscience research indicates that during these peak states, our brains undergo remarkable changes. A specific combination of neurochemicals—including dopamine, norepinephrine, anandamide, and serotonin—floods our neural pathways, temporarily altering our cognitive function. This natural chemical cocktail enhances creativity, accelerates learning, and reduces self-consciousness, allowing us to perform at levels that might otherwise seem unattainable.

The Core Psychological Elements of Peak Performance

Peak productivity states don't materialize randomly. They emerge from specific psychological conditions that work in concert:

1. Singular Focus

The human brain isn't wired for multitasking. Contemporary research from cognitive science demonstrates that attempting to handle multiple complex tasks simultaneously can decrease productivity by up to 40%. During peak performance states, attention narrows dramatically, allowing our cognitive resources to concentrate on a single objective.

2. Structured Goals with Immediate Feedback

Our brains thrive on clarity and reinforcement. When objectives are precisely defined and we can instantly gauge our progress toward them, motivation remains consistently high. This continuous feedback loop creates momentum that sustains effort, whether you're solving complex equations or developing business strategies.

3. Optimal Challenge Threshold

Tasks that don't stretch our abilities lead to disengagement, while those far beyond our capabilities trigger anxiety. The productivity sweet spot lies where challenges slightly exceed current skills—creating the perfect tension that drives growth without overwhelming our cognitive resources.

4. Self-Determined Motivation

While external rewards can temporarily boost performance, research consistently demonstrates that intrinsic motivation—engaging in activities because they're inherently satisfying—creates the most sustainable foundation for peak productivity. Psychological Pathways to Peak Performance

Beyond environmental design, specific mental practices can help activate and sustain peak performance states more reliably.

1. Present-Moment Awareness Training

Clinical studies demonstrate that mind-wandering—which occupies approximately half our waking hours—substantially reduces both cognitive performance and subjective well-being. Systematic attention training develops the capacity to remain present, establishing the foundation for sustained productivity.

2. Working With Your Cognitive Rhythms

Our mental capacity naturally fluctuates throughout the day in approximately 90-minute cycles known as ultradian rhythms. By aligning your work schedule with these natural ebbs and flows, you can maximize productive output while minimizing fatigue. For students and business owners with demanding schedules, this approach might include:

  • Scheduling intensive work sessions during your personal peak cognitive periods
  • Integrating strategic recovery breaks between focused blocks
  • Matching task complexity to your energy levels throughout the day

3. Productive Stress Management

Counter to common belief, eliminating all stress isn't optimal for performance. Research indicates that moderate stress—often called "eustress"—actually enhances cognitive function and motivation. The key distinction lies in perceived control and meaning; stress becomes productive when we view challenges as meaningful and manageable.

Overcoming Internal Barriers to Peak Performance

Even with ideal external conditions, several psychological obstacles can prevent us from achieving our productive potential.

The Perfectionism Trap

While excellence-oriented thinking can drive quality, perfectionism often undermines productivity by creating paralysis and procrastination. Research indicates that perfectionistic tendencies correlate with increased stress, reduced output, and diminished creative thinking.

To overcome perfectionistic blocks:

  • Implement time constraints that necessitate completion over idealization
  • Adopt staged approaches that separate creation from refinement
  • Develop "good enough" criteria for different project phases
  • Practice self-compassion when evaluating your work

This mindset recalibration is particularly valuable for students completing assignments and business owners launching new initiatives. Remember that in most contexts, completed work delivers more value than perpetually refined but unfinished projects.

The Motivation Misconception

A common productivity misconception holds that we should "feel motivated" before beginning important work. This belief creates dependence on unreliable emotional states. Contemporary motivation research demonstrates that engaged action typically precedes motivational feelings, not the reverse.

For moments when motivation seems absent:

  • Commit to minimal viable engagement (even just five minutes)
  • Decompose complex projects into smaller action steps
  • Establish external accountability structures
  • Connect immediate tasks with meaningful long-term outcomes

Frequently Asked Questions About Peak Performance Psychology

How long does establishing peak performance habits typically take?

Research on habit formation indicates that new behavioral patterns typically require between 18 and 254 days to become automatic, with most people averaging around 66 days. Consistency matters more than perfection. Starting with small, manageable adjustments significantly increases your likelihood of lasting change.

Are certain personality types more predisposed to experiencing flow states?

While some temperamental traits may facilitate easier access to flow states, research indicates that virtually everyone can experience peak performance states given appropriate conditions and practice. The critical variables involve task difficulty, skill level, and attentional management—not inherent personality characteristics.

What distinguishes genuine peak performance from simply working intensely?

Peak performance states have several distinctive characteristics: altered time perception (hours passing like minutes), reduced self-consciousness, seemingly effortless concentration, and a sense of control and capability. During ordinary hard work, you typically remain highly aware of your efforts, the passage of time, and experience more subjective strain.

Do productivity applications help or hinder achieving peak performance?

The impact of productivity tools depends entirely on implementation. Research suggests that applications reducing cognitive load and eliminating distractions can enhance performance, while those adding complexity or creating interruptions may impede it. Effective tools simplify your workflow rather than introducing additional complexity.
